How do I grant permissions to a user group I have created?

If I have created a new user group how do I grant permissions to it?

It depends on the permissions you want to grant. 

  1. If you want to have permissions over issues in a project, you can edit the permission scheme your project is associated to (JIRA Administration > Issues > Permission Scheme) or even manage this under the roles from your projects (Which will be reflected according to your permission scheme)
  2. If you want to have permissions under your instance itself in order to have administrative privileges, you can edit the Global Permissions or your instance (JIRA Administration > System > Global Permissions) and place this group to be a member of the JIRA Administrators role.
